Ridgway Man Faces Drug, Theft Charges

RIDGWAY TOWNSHIP – A 31-year-old Ridgway man faces charges after allegedly stealing prescription medication and attempting to sell it Friday in Ridgway Township, Elk County.

The Ridgway-based state police identified the man as Joshua Smith, 31, of Ridgway. He’s been charged with manufacture, deliver, possession with intent to deliver a controlled substance, theft by unlawful taking or disposition, receiving stolen property and possession of a controlled substance.

According to the report, Smith was at a 22-year-old Ridgway woman’s apartment, where he allegedly stole the prescription medication. Through further investigation, Smith was located at the Ridgway Elks Club, attempting to sell the prescription medication in the parking lot.

Smith was taken into custody and arraigned in district court. His bail was set at $25,000 monetary. Smith was placed in the Elk County Prison.
